Ordinance - 366ORDINANCE NO.366
AN ORDINANCE O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F WEST COVINA,
CALIFORNIA, RESTRICTING OR PROHIBITING THE.PARKING OF VEHICLES
ON CERTAIN STREETS IN SAID CITY.AND.DECLARING THE URGENCY.
HEREOF.
SECTION 1. 'When authorized signs are in place giving
notice thereof no person shall stop, stand or park any vehicle
on any of the following described streets or portions of streets
between the hours of 1:00 otclock A.M., and 6:00 o'clock P.M.,
of any day except Sundays and holidays for a longer period of
time than two (2) hours, to wit:
Garvey Boulevard, from _California Avenue to
Glendora Avenue;
Glendora Avenue, from Garvey Boulevard to Walnut
Creek 'Wash.
SECTION 2. The term «streets" as used in this Ordinance
shall include public streets, highways, avenues, lanes, alleys,
courts, places, squares, curbs or other public ways in said City
which have been or may hereafter be dedicated and open to public
use or such other public property so designated in any law of
this State.
i� SECTION 3. This Ordinance is urgently required for the
immediate preservation of the public health, peace and safety and
is hereby declared to be an urgency measure therefor and shall
take effect and be in full force immediately upon its adoption and
passage. A declaration of the facts constituting its urgency is
as -'ollows: The stopping, sta ding or parking of vehicles for a
longer period of time than two hours at the locations specified
-1-
hereinabove will interfere with and endanger persons, property
or traffic and will adversely affect or endanger the public
peace, health and safety and will constitute a menace or hazard
to pedestrians or other traffic in or about said locations and
will cause needless, excessive congestion of people and vehicles
in said locations.
SECTION 4. Any person, firm or coporation violating
any of the provisions of this Ordinance shall be guilty of a
misdemeanor, and upon conviction thereof shall be punishable by
a fine of not more than Five Hundred Dollars ($500.00) or by
imprisonment in the County Jail for a period of not more than
ninety days, or both such fine and imprisonment. Each such person,
firm or corporation shall be deemed -guilty of a separate offense
for every day during any portion of which any violation of any
provisions of this ordinance is committed, continued or permitted
by such person, firm or corporation, and shall be punishable
therefor as provided for in this Ordinance.
SECTION 5. The City Clerk shall certify to the passage
of this Ordinance and shall cause the same to be published once
in the West Covina Tribune, a newspaper of general circulation
published and circulated in the City of West Covina.
